Einhard's biography of the Carolingian Empire's founder The Life of
Charlemagne (Vita Karoli Magni) is one of the most famous pieces of
literature on the early Middle Ages. It is both an epic and
personal account of the legendary warrior king who was known as the
Father of Europe, providing a fascinating insight into his
political success, battlefield strategy, foreign and domestic
policies, friends, enemies, and personal habits. For scholars of
military science, it is an essential bridge text linking the
masterworks of ancient strategy like The Art of War and Commentarii
de Bello Gallico with the future writings of Machiavelli,
Clausewitz, et al.
